Postby mytielwoody on Fri Oct 09, 2009 5:48 pm

Well, the room change was a big adjustment....probably the biggest for me though! Ivy was upset about the move for the first day.....then she was back to normal! None of the others cared too much. Yes, they had all been right in the middle of everything int he living room.(cages were taking over!) I have found there to be alot of good things and some bad about moving them into their own room. The best is that I think they sleep alot better in there at night. Also they are alot safer in there as I can shut the door at anytime we have the outside door open for any length of time. Pip sleeps out of cage at night, so having them in their own room makes that a safer thing now. He stays put, but I can now shut the door and there's no danger of him running around on the floor and getting stepped on. He gets up earlier in the morning than the rest of the birds and goes to Ivy's cage and sleeps under her cover til we get them up. (he loves Ivy) The bad side of them having their own room is that I don't have them right with me every second like I used to! Yes, the interaction between us has slowed just a little bit though, but we make due and I am going to make them a play area in the living room so they can spend more time out here again.
I know with cockatiels they tend to get grumpy at night when they get tired. Mine always have their little spats over where they're going to sleep for the night. they will fight over the same spot probably about half the time....then the rest of the times they settle in peacefully. They never hiss or bite, but I have heard a hiss or two from them at night rarely.
